Hitchcock Insect Club is a grassroots club made up of local individuals who are passionate about bugs, and they want YOU to join in the fun! New insect topics will be discussed each month, Hitchcock Insect Club meets every fourth Thursday of the month, May through September.
The featured insect will be presented by Loren Padelford
What makes Odonates such successful and superb predators? We’ll discuss some of the key features to their success and show some of the common odes and how to identify them.
